"We Bought a Funeral Home" is a reality television series that follows the lives of the Middelthon family as they run their family-owned funeral home in Stoughton, Wisconsin. The show premiered on the FYI network in 2015 and has since aired two seasons.
The show has been praised for its honest and heartwarming portrayal of the Middelthon family and their work. It has also been praised for its educational value, as it provides viewers with a behind-the-scenes look at the funeral industry.
In the second season of "We Bought a Funeral Home," the Middelthon family faces a number of challenges, including the death of a loved one and the financial struggles of running a small business. However, they also experience moments of joy and laughter, as they come together to support each other through difficult times.
